Today, we had a service call out in Upper Marlboro, a city in Prince George’s County, Maryland. The customer had an issue with 2 solar microinverters which were “Not Reporting” in the system. This simply means the there was issue with solar production from these two connections.
Upon arrival, the first step always includes physical inspection of the solar installation. This is were we climb on the roof and take a thorough look at the setup.
First, we inspected the panels for physical damage and noticed that there was not dame to the panels. Often times, hail or falling trees can cause damage. Next, we had to remove the solar panels to inspect underneath and see if there may be short circuits and test for current drops on the panels and micro inverters.
The Cause of the Problem




Immediately, upon removal of the panels, we noticed damage to the solar cables surrounding the panels and the micros. This damage caused the micro inverters, often referred as the micros, to go offline. Instead of simply repairing the damage, we train our techs to prevent future damages. So they had to figure out what caused the damage in the first place.
Upon further inspection, our techs concluded that the damage was due to squirrel bites. Often times in areas surrounded by trees, squirrels will take shade under the solar panels. While there, the bite and chew away at anything they can get their teeth on.
The Remedy
The first steps were to replace any heavily corroded cables. We also sealed the slightly less damaged cables and insulated them with insulation tape. This prevents water from getting into the baling in the future and causing more damage from electrical water shortages. Once the repairs were complete, we reinstalled the micros and reconnected the solar panels.
The Reco
We took images of the damage and showed it to the home owner with recommendations on how to prevent future damage. This reco included installation of squirrel guards which would prevent squirrels, birds and any other predators from getting in. The home owner gladly agreed and we completed the job in a day.
